For the uninitiated, Kingdom Business is an American musical drama series created and executive produced by John J. Sakmar and Kerry Lenhart. The show premiered on BET+ in May 2022 and was renewed for a second season in February 2023. The series centers around gospel queen Denita Jordan and her challenge from an up-and-coming young singer with a troubled past.

Is Kingdom Business Season 2 officially renewed?
Production has begun in Atlanta for the second season of BET+’s hit music-oriented drama series, Kingdom Business, which has been renewed by the network. The series is executive produced by DeVon Franklin (known for Miracles From Heaven), Holly Carter (producer of The Clark Sisters: The First Ladies of Gospel), multi-Grammy-award-winner Kirk Franklin, and Michael Van Dyck.
Kingdom Business, written by John Sakmar and Kerry Lenhart, delves into the gospel music industry with a focus on family, faith, love, and the transformative nature of music.

The show centers around Denita, played by Yolanda Adams, a well-known gospel celebrity who is also the First Lady of First Kingdom Church and oversees the record label Kingdom Records. Denita is fiercely protective of her family and is willing to go to great lengths to keep their secrets hidden.
Despite her success, Denita’s world begins to crumble when a new challenger in the gospel music industry threatens her position. Enter Rbel, played by Serayah, a rising star with a checkered past as an exotic dancer. Despite her unconventional background, Rbel’s newly discovered voice is set to turn the gospel world on its head and give Denita a run for her money.

What is the cast of Kingdom Business Season 2?
There is currently no official announcement regarding the cast of the upcoming season of Kingdom Business. However, it’s expected that many of the series regulars and main characters from previous seasons will return for the next installment. Some potential cast members that have been suggested include Yolanda Adams as Denita Jordan, Serayah as Rebecca “Rbel” Belle, Michael Jai White as Julius “Caesar” Jones, Michael Beach as Calvin Jordan, Chaundre A. Hall-Broomfield as Taj Jordan, Dominique Johnson as Malcolm Walker, Tamar Braxton as Sasha, La’Myia Good as Essence, Aspen Kennedy as Zyan, Kiandra Richardson as C.J. Jordan-Walker, Kajuana S. Marie as Dani, Sam Malone as Dex, Louis Gossett Jr. as Bishop Jeremiah West, and Patrice Fisher as Detective Juanita Parker.
